**Ticket: TRC-88 — Cross-Service Request Tracing**

We need consistent trace propagation across the Lanternwork microservices, including the billing and notification hops where span context is currently dropped. Please implement header forwarding per the tracing spec, verify in staging with the Glimmer dashboard, and document any gaps. Before merging, this work requires written sign-off from the person named below.

account owner for bawip-tahag: Raleth Quenok

## Deployment

This branch reverts the Pellinor query planner to cost model v2 after the v3 regression caused full scans on partitioned tables. Deploy proceeds in two waves: read replicas first, then the primary after a one-hour soak. Reviewers should verify the feature flag stays pinned until the fix lands upstream. The planner service must start with the configuration below.

service settings:
PRAWYN_PIN=9848
PRAWYN_METRICS_HOST=metrics.prawyn.lumicworks.corp
PRAWYN_LOG_LEVEL=warn
PRAWYN_TENANT=pelius

### Broker Upgrades

Support staff should understand how Corvexa rolls out message broker upgrades, since customers often notice brief redelivery bursts during the maintenance window. Upgrades proceed node by node; duplicate deliveries are expected and idempotent consumers absorb them silently. If a customer reports message loss (not duplication), treat it as an incident, not upgrade noise. Scheduled windows, version matrices, and the customer-notification template are all kept on the internal page below.

dashboard of tawef-yageg = https://jira.torvaworks.corp/deploy/merge_requests/board/settings/issue/settings/build/86c86b97dff3e2041bd6f497